Many great entrepreneurs come at innovation through acquiring a company instead of founding one. Join the Blank Center with fellow Babson students and alumni for an evening discussion about Entrepreneurship Through Acquisition where we will explore Search Funds -- the deal sourcing and financing process as well as general advice on how to evaluate and find acquisition opportunities. Our experts will approach this topic from the searcher, business broker, and experienced entrepreneur perspectives. If you have considered entrepreneurship, and haven’t found your Next Big Idea, or if you are curious about alternatives to starting a business from scratch, this event is for you. Chris Fuller
Chris Fuller joined Search Fund Accelerator as a Principal in 2017. Prior to joining SFA, Chris was a Principal at Checketts Partners Investment Fund, a New York City-based growth equity firm that focused on investing in sports, media and entertainment companies. Previously, Chris worked at Credit Suisse in the Mergers & Acquisitions Group with a focus on industrial, aerospace / defense and technology transactions.

Chris holds a MBA from Harvard Business School and a BA, cum laude, from Harvard University where I rowed on the varsity crew team.

Thomas Malloy '04

Thomas Malloy is Managing Director at Stage Harbor Group, LLC established in 2008 and is also Founder of the Equire.co marketplace platform. Thomas has over 15 years of experience in investment management and financial services, holding positions including Director at UBS Investment Bank and Vice President at MKP Capital Management. Thomas is also the Program Manager for the “Entrepreneurship through Acquisition” Search Fund course at Harvard Business School. He is passionate about helping motivated individuals partake in entrepreneurship through the acquisition of smaller firms. Thomas resides in New York City, He received his MBA from IE Business School in Madrid and B.S. degree in Finance & Entrepreneurship from Babson College.

Amanda McCarthy '09
As Managing Director for Pearson Coast Capital, Amanda is responsible for finding, negotiating, and closing an acquisition on behalf of the partnership in addition to leading the PCC team of analysts. In conjunction with Pearson Coast Capital’s investment, she will join the acquired company’s current management team to ensure a smooth transition and continued success.

Prior to Pearson Coast Capital and while pursuing a full-time MBA at IESE Business School, Amanda consulted local startups in Spain and 15+ other countries across four continents alongside launching her own e-commerce marketplace for independent artisans. While her career began in technology as a Software Engineer at Fidelity Investments, she later joined a boutique investment management firm in downtown Boston where she had the opportunity to wear several hats within operations, technology, and research. Before deciding to pursue a full-time MBA, she returned to Fidelity in a product marketing role as part of the web data governance team, being the liaison between the product and technology teams responsible for the mutual fund customer experience on Fidelity.com. Outside of work, she enjoys cooking, road cycling, travel, and spending time with her husband, Pat, and their 5-year-old yorkie, Bruin.

Amanda holds a Bilingual MBA from IESE Business School as well as a BA in Business Administration with a concentration in Finance from Babson College.

Patrick McCarthy '09 MS'09
As Operating Principal for Pearson Coast Capital, Patrick is responsible for finding, negotiating, and closing an acquisition on behalf of the partnership. In conjunction with Pearson Coast Capital’s investment, he will join the acquired company’s current management team and be responsible for overseeing daily operations.

Prior to founding Pearson Coast Capital, Patrick assisted with the inorganic growth strategy of a portfolio company by sourcing and evaluating opportunities as an investor for Summit Partners, a Boston-based growth equity firm. Also while at Summit, he was responsible for all aspects of the general partner funds and assisted with the reporting to the limited partners. Beginning his career at PwC, Patrick worked as a healthcare tax consultant and as an associate for alternative investment tax compliance. Outside of work, he enjoys coaching youth hockey among other hobbies.

Patrick holds an MBA from IESE Business School as well as a Masters in Professional Accounting and a BA in Business Administration from Babson College. While at Babson, he was a member of the school’s DIII varsity hockey team and spent his weekends working as a personal assistant for the Cerebral Palsy of Massachusetts. He is also a Certified Public Accountant (CPA).
